push ((flip ($)) ((flip ($)) Haskell) . ((.) . cons)) name_2: | catchFail | | | push ((flip ($)) ((flip ($)) ((flip ($)) ((flip ($)) Haskell . (cons . const Haskell)) . ((.) . (cons . const Haskell))) . ((.) . ((.) . (cons . const Haskell)))) . ((.) . ((.) . ((.) . (cons . const Haskell))))) | | read | | lift ($) | | read | | lift ($) | | read | | lift ($) | | read | | lift ($) | | popFail | | ret | | loadInput | fail call name_2 lift ($) name_1: | catchFail | | | push ((.) . cons) | | call name_2 | | lift ($) | | call name_1 | | lift ($) | | popFail | | ret | | pushInput | lift InstrPureSameOffset | choices [id] | | | push id | | ret | | fail call name_1 lift ($) ret